ConocoPhillips (COP) actively positions itself in the evolving energy sector by filing a new Shelf Registration, a strategic maneuver that enhances its ability to raise capital flexibly. This new filing allows the independent oil and gas producer to be prepared for various market conditions without the need to pin down an offering date or amount at this moment. By doing so, ConocoPhillips aims to leverage potential shifts in the energy industry more effectively, demonstrating its agility in responding to economic conditions and sector demands. This move may provide them with a competitive edge, especially as the energy landscape is characterized by fluctuations in supply and demand.
ConocoPhillips Strengthens Market Position Through Strategic Index Inclusions
The recent inclusion of ConocoPhillips in both the Russell 1000 Defensive Index and the Russell 1000 Value-Defensive Index further solidifies the company’s reputation in the market. These indices are known for highlighting firms that maintain stability during economic downturns, positioning ConocoPhillips as a resilient player in the oil and gas sector. The company's recognition in these indices is particularly noteworthy given the current volatility in energy markets, as it reflects the belief that ConocoPhillips can withstand economic fluctuations better than many of its peers. This status not only reassures investors but also enhances ConocoPhillips’ appeal as a reliable option amidst uncertainty.
